17 lines
584 B
TypeScript
17 lines
584 B
TypeScript
import path from "node:path";
|
||
import react from "@vitejs/plugin-react";
|
||
import { defineConfig } from "vite";
|
||
|
||
export default defineConfig({
|
||
/** Подхватываем .env из корня репозитория (рядом с Next), если в подпапке своего нет */
|
||
envDir: path.resolve(__dirname, ".."),
|
||
/** Как в Next: можно копировать .env с NEXT_PUBLIC_API / NEXT_PUBLIC_S3_BUCKET */
|
||
envPrefix: ["VITE_", "NEXT_PUBLIC_"],
|
||
plugins: [react()],
|
||
resolve: {
|
||
alias: {
|
||
"@": path.resolve(__dirname, "./src"),
|
||
},
|
||
},
|
||
});
|